Discover the enchanting September weather in Yablunytsia, Ukraine. This month offers a pleasant maximum temperature of 25°C (78°F), while the average temperature settles around a cool 12°C (53°F), dipping to a refreshing minimum of -2°C (28°F) at night. With a total precipitation of 85 mm (3.3 in) spread across 12 days, it's a time when the landscape is both vibrant and lush. The humidity level sits comfortably at 71%, adding to the crisp, invigorating feel of the early autumn air. In September, Yablunytsia experiences a moderate humidity level of 71%, marking a transition as summer gives way to autumn. This month reflects a slight increase from the drier conditions of August, which recorded a low of 60%. Notably, humidity levels begin to rise again in the fall, following a general trend where months in the latter half of the year tend to be more humid compared to their summer counterparts. This pattern culminates in the winter months, with January peaking at 92%. As summer gradually yields to autumn in Yablunytsia, Ukraine, September marks a noticeable shift in daylight duration. After basking in up to 16 hours of daylight in June, the days begin to shorten, with September offering a more moderate 12 hours of light. This reflects a steady decline from the peak of summer, preparing the region for the crisp embrace of fall. The transition is gentle yet evident, as daylight wanes further in October to just 10 hours, continuing a downward trend that began in late summer.
